This essay provides a comprehensive overview of contemporary management issues in the 21st century, emphasizing the concepts of effectuation and causation as they relate to entrepreneurial practices. It examines how businesses, particularly through the lens of entrepreneurial ventures, navigate the dynamic global environment. The essay delves into the definitions, applications, and impacts of effectuation and causation on entrepreneurial mindsets, highlighting the importance of value creation for customers over mere profit generation. It explores the principles of effectuation, such as the bird-in-hand, affordable loss, crazy quilt, and pilot-in-the-plane principles, and contrasts them with the causation approach, which focuses on pre-determined objectives. The discussion includes how entrepreneurs adapt strategies to overcome uncertainties in the contemporary business environment, manage risks, and leverage technological advancements to enhance customer experiences. The essay also analyzes how these theoretical frameworks influence decision-making and strategic planning in the context of leadership, commercialization, and innovation. The conclusion reinforces the significance of these concepts for entrepreneurs in navigating the challenges and opportunities of the modern business world, including the impact of global dislocations and the importance of adaptable strategies.
